5个关键步骤:如何制定完美的系统验收标准?

系统验收标准的重要性与制定原则

系统验收标准是衡量一个系统是否满足预期需求和功能的关键指标。制定合理的系统验收标准不仅能确保系统质量,还能提高项目成功率。本文将深入探讨系统验收标准的制定方法、关键要素以及在实际应用中的注意事项,帮助读者更好地把控系统开发过程,实现高质量的系统交付。

系统验收标准的构成要素

一个完善的系统验收标准通常包括以下几个关键要素:

1. 功能性需求:系统应具备的核心功能和特性,包括各项业务流程、数据处理能力等。

2. 性能指标:系统在不同负载条件下的响应时间、并发处理能力、资源利用率等。

3. 安全性要求:数据加密、访问控制、权限管理、防攻击措施等安全相关的标准。

4. 可用性和可靠性:系统的稳定运行时间、故障恢复能力、数据备份与恢复机制等。

5. 用户体验:界面设计、操作流程、帮助文档等与用户交互相关的标准。

6. 兼容性和集成性:与其他系统或平台的兼容情况,以及数据交换和集成能力。

7. 可扩展性:系统未来升级和扩展的可能性和难度评估。

制定系统验收标准的方法

制定科学合理的系统验收标准需要遵循以下步骤:

1. 明确系统目标:首先要理解系统的核心目标和业务需求,这是制定验收标准的基础。

2. 收集需求:与各方利益相关者沟通,全面收集功能性和非功能性需求。

3. 分析可行性:评估需求的技术可行性和成本效益,确保验收标准切实可行。

4. 设定具体指标:将需求转化为可量化、可测试的具体指标。

5. 制定测试方案:根据验收标准设计相应的测试用例和测试方法。

6. 建立评分机制:为每项验收标准设定权重和评分标准,以便最终评估系统是否通过验收。

7. 评审和修订:组织各方对验收标准进行评审,根据反馈意见进行修订和完善。

在这个过程中,使用专业的项目管理工具可以大大提高效率。ONES研发管理平台提供了完善的需求管理、测试管理和项目协作功能,能够帮助团队更好地制定和执行系统验收标准。

系统验收标准的执行与评估

制定了系统验收标准后,还需要正确执行和评估:

1. 准备验收环境:搭建与生产环境相似的测试环境,确保验收测试的真实性。

2. 执行验收测试:按照预定的测试方案进行全面测试,记录测试结果。

3. 问题跟踪与修复:对发现的问题进行分类、优先级排序,并跟踪修复进度。

4. 重新验证:对修复后的问题进行重新测试,确保所有问题都得到解决。

5. 评估验收结果:根据预设的评分机制,对系统的各项指标进行评分和总结。

6. 验收报告:编写详细的验收报告,包括测试过程、结果分析和改进建议。

7. 最终决策:基于验收报告,决定系统是否通过验收,是否需要进一步改进。

系统验收标准

系统验收标准的优化与迭代

随着项目的进展和技术的发展,系统验收标准也需要不断优化和迭代:

1. 定期回顾:根据实际执行情况,定期回顾验收标准的合理性和有效性。

2. 收集反馈:持续收集用户和开发团队的反馈,了解系统在实际使用中的表现。

3. 跟踪行业标准:关注行业最新标准和最佳实践,及时调整验收标准。

4. 技术更新:随着新技术的应用,相应调整系统的性能指标和功能要求。

5. 优化流程:根据执行经验,不断优化验收流程,提高效率和准确性。

6. 知识沉淀:将验收过程中积累的经验和教训形成知识库,为future的项目提供参考。

7. 持续改进:对于未通过验收的项目,分析原因并制定改进计划,不断提高系统质量。

系统验收标准的制定和执行是一个复杂的过程,需要项目团队的密切协作。使用适当的协作工具可以显著提高工作效率。ONES研发管理平台提供了全面的项目管理解决方案,包括需求管理、测试管理、任务协作等功能,能够帮助团队更好地制定、执行和优化系统验收标准。

结论:系统验收标准的重要性与未来展望

系统验收标准是确保系统质量和项目成功的关键要素。通过制定科学合理的验收标准,我们能够明确项目目标,提高系统质量,增强用户满意度。随着技术的不断发展和业务需求的变化,系统验收标准也需要持续优化和完善。未来,随着人工智能和大数据技术的应用,系统验收标准的制定和执行将变得更加智能化和自动化,为软件开发和项目管理带来新的机遇和挑战。作为项目管理者和开发人员,我们应该密切关注这一领域的发展,不断学习和创新,以应对未来的挑战和机遇。